Zuraikat Folds a Pair; Stoica First Out

Level 1 : Blinds 100/300, 300 ante
Ramzi Zuraikat
Ramzi Zuraikat

Adrian Mateos raised to 700 in the cutoff and was called by Maxim Panyak on the button before small blind Ramzi Zuraikat three-bet to 2,100 in the small blind.

Both Mateos and Panyak called to the A96 flop, where Zuraikat bet another 2,600. Panyak called, while Mateos got out of the way heading to the Q turn.

Zuraikat slowed down and checked as Panyak fired out 5,200. Zuraikat turned over 88 and tossed them into the muck as Panyak took the pot.

Earlier on the day, Zuraikat won a massive pot off Roman Stoica, and the guys at PokerFirma told PokerNews the details.

There was 6,500 in the pot on the 1086J board and Zuraikat had a bet of 27,200 in front of him, indicating there was some previous action on the turn. Stoica moved all in for 98,000, covering Zuraikat by 4,000. The latter went deep into the tank and eventually called.

Ramzi Zuraikat: 66
Roman Stoica: A10

Zuraikat was behind with his set and needed the board to pair to survive. He called for the full house, and the dealer complied by finishing the board off with the 8. A few hands later, Stoica was eliminated.

Duc Tuan Tran was also recently eliminated.
